Output 3bdccf4f4f8e9800bd94c16e3a603f70d68d045b7134c96781168c60d7663da2:8

value
26722682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fe9cf7f4f1796c509e7245d59f272ef7e2c574 OP_EQUAL
address
MFHRJcGz8R4sWXuRPJ6caZ2DbKgFhme1Fu
transaction
3bdccf4f4f8e9800bd94c16e3a603f70d68d045b7134c96781168c60d7663da2
spent
true